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ina witnessed the entire second half of the
final match between Palestine and Burundi at the stadium.

Welcoming the countries taking part in the tournament, the premier
said, “I hope you have liked our country. Bangladesh is a beautiful
country. I wish you will come again and again and participate in our
tournaments. We will hold these types of tournaments more in future.”

The premier congratulated — the organizers, supporters, countries
taking part in the extravaganza and the people concerned — for
successfully organizing the prestigious Bangabandhu Gold Cup
International Football Tournament, 2020, marking the birth centenary of
Father of the Nation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ujibur Rahman.

A former Brazilian goalkeeper Júlio César, who attended as special guest
of the Bangabandhu Gold Cup tournament, exchanged pleasantries with Prime
Minister Sheikh Hasina soon after she arrived at the stadium.

César, who arrived in Dhaka on Wednesday on a two-day visit at the
invitation of Bangladesh Football Federation (BFF), witnessed the final
match at the stadium.

State Minister for Ministry of Youth and Sports Md. Zahid Ahsan Russel,
Bangladesh Football Federation (BFF) President Kazi Md. Salahuddin and
Senior Vice-President Abdus Salam Murshedy, among others, were
present, on the occasion.

The 11-day Bangabandhu Gold Cup International Football Tournament,
2020, which began on January 15 at the Bangabandhu National Stadium,
ended with the final match this evening.

A total of six countries — Sri Lanka, Laos, Cambodia, Mongolia, Kyrgyzstan and host Bangladesh – took
part in the eleven day meet
